I'm running Metropolis build12. There are actually 2 issues to this bug. Bug #1 ====== Currently the .desktop file for Java Control Panel is installed to the wrong location. According to the Metropolis UI spec the following menu option should exist: Launch->Preferences->Desktop Preferences->Java which should launch the Java Control Panel. But because the .desktop file (sun_java.desktop) is installed to "/usr/java/jre/plugin/desktop" gnome-vfs does not pick this file up and no menu entry is created in gnome-panel. The sun_java.desktop file should be installed to "/<%install_prefix>/share/control-center-2.0/capplets". Bug #2 ====== The "Exec" and the "Icon" paths for the sun_java.desktop file will need to be changed - currently they are set to: Exec: INSTALL_DIR/JRE_NAME_VERSION/bin/ControlPanel Icon: INSTALL_DIR/JRE_NAME_VERSION/plugin/desktop/sun_java.png They should be set to (for Metropolis/Solaris) Exec: ControlPanel Icon: sun_java.png Note: currently the %install_prefix is /opt/jds but this is to change to /usr going forward from Metropolis_13 ###@###.### 10/19/04 09:31 GMT
